  1. One of the main ways in which QC is expected to change machine learning is by enabling more powerful and efficient algorithms. Quantum computers have the ability to perform certain types of computations significantly faster than classical computers, which could make it possible to solve machine-learning problems that are currently too complex or time-consuming for classical computers to handle. This could lead to more advanced and effective machine learning systems, with applications in a wide range of fields.
